💔 Why Do Some Women Need Donated Eggs?
Statistics show that around 15% of couples worldwide experience infertility — meaning roughly one in seven couples faces challenges conceiving.
The causes vary widely and are not always within a woman’s control:
Advanced maternal age leading to declining ovarian function
Congenital ovarian insufficiency (undeveloped ovaries)
Loss of ovulation due to surgery or infection
Genetic disorders that prevent embryo development

🌏 Egg Donation Regulations: Taiwan vs. the U.S.
Different countries have different rules for egg donation.
Most Taiwanese women either donate locally or travel to the U.S. for higher compensation and broader medical options.
In Taiwan, egg donation is legal under the Assisted Reproduction Act.
Donors must meet specific medical and age criteria:
| Requirement | Description |
|---|---|
| Age | 20–35 years old |
| Height | At least 155 cm |
| BMI | Between 18–24 |
| Donation Frequency | Once only (if embryos were implanted successfully, further donations are not allowed) |
| Health Status | Must have good ovarian function, no hereditary or infectious diseases |
🇺🇸 U.S. Egg Donation Requirements
Egg donation in the U.S. generally involves three major categories: physiological, psychological, and physical appearance requirements.

【Physiological Requirements】
| Item | Description |
|---|---|
| Age | 19–31 years old |
| Blood Type | Any, as long as known |
| Genetic Health | No genetic disorders such as Hepatitis B/C, epilepsy, or hemophilia |
| Infectious Diseases | Must test negative for HIV, syphilis, and other infections |
| Lifestyle Habits | No smoking, alcohol, or drug use |
| Menstrual Health | Regular menstrual cycles |
| Experience | Prior donation experience is a plus (U.S. limit: 6 donations per lifetime) |
【Psychological Requirements】
| Item | Description |
|---|---|
| Mental Health | No psychological disorders, no antidepressant medication usage |
| Evaluation | A U.S.-licensed psychologist conducts a one-on-one assessment to ensure emotional stability and informed consent |
【Physical Appearance Requirements】

| Item | Description |
|---|---|
| Height | At least 160 cm |
| BMI | 18.5–24 |
| Facial Features | Symmetrical, pleasant appearance |
| Lifestyle Habits | No smoking, drinking, drug use, or chronic sleep deprivation |
| Education | High school diploma minimum; college degree preferred |
In general, most agencies share similar criteria, though some may have additional preferences or screening requirements.
